Episode 39: Trench Safety Stand Down, Featuring T.J. Bryson of United Rentals

Dig This's Bob Baylor talks to T.J. Bryson about the upcoming Trench Safety Stand Down Week. NUCA National Partner United Rentals is a long-time sponsor and of TSSD and has a world-class trench safety program of their own. They help contractors strengthen our member's safety culture through OSHA-focused training and helping them to conduct toolbox talks with their employees. TSSD has grown over the past decade into a nationwide week of focused safety awareness for the underground construction industry, and Bob and T.J. talk about this important NUCA safety program and its future.

Episode 37: Featuring Keith McLaughlin, Executive Director Colorado Resources and Power Authority

In this edition, NUCA's Robert Baylor talks to Keith McLaughlin, executive director of the Colorado Water Resources and Power Development Authority about his state's program administering the Clean Water and Drinking Water state revolving funds. Keith describes how this resource flows from Washington to Colorado communities, and how utility contractors get involved in his state's infrastructure projects. https://www.cwrpda.com/
